PORT CHALMERS DOCK.
'To the Editor, Sir, —Surely you must be in error in stating that the cost of filling the boilers with water at the new Graving Dock cost Ll2, 1 have filled them for less than Ll each, “chock a block,” and I am prepared to do so again as often as required. 1 am, &c. Wm. Goldie. Port Chalmers. [We refer our Correspondent, for iniformation to Messrs. Connor and M’Kay, who paid the sum mentioned by us.— Ed. E.S.]
